How Bayern Munich could line up against Paris Saint-Germain

Sports Mole takes an in-depth look at how Bayern Munich could line up for Wednesday's Champions League last-16 second leg against Paris Saint-Germain.

Bayern Munich manager Julian Nagelsmann must cope without the suspended Benjamin Pavard for Wednesday's Champions League last-16 second leg with Paris Saint-Germain at the Allianz Arena.

The Frenchman was sent off towards the end of the Bavarians' first-leg win at the Parc des Princes three weeks ago, and his absence leaves the Bayern boss with quite the predicament at the back.

Yann Sommer's spot in goal is safe as Manuel Neuer recovers from a broken leg, while Matthijs de Ligt and Dayot Upamecano will protect the Switzerland shot-stopper as ever.

Josip Stanisic was given a run-out in the back three against Stuttgart and could now deputise for the suspended Pavard, whose compatriot Lucas Hernandez is also out with an ACL injury.

Despite Noussair Mazraoui's continued absence, Joao Cancelo's recent stint of substitute appearances may continue as Kingsley Coman and Alphonso Davies line up out wide for Bayern.

Joshua Kimmich and Leon Goretzka will line up in the middle as ever, while Leroy Sane can feel confident of winning the battle with Thomas Muller to join Jamal Musiala in the final third.

Fresh from signing a contract extension, Eric Maxim Choupo-Moting will lead the line for the hosts, although Sadio Mane is a fit-again option off the bench for Nagelsmann.

Bayern Munich possible starting lineup: Sommer; Stanisic, Upamecano, De Ligt; Coman, Kimmich, Goretzka, Davies; Sane, Musiala; Choupo-Moting
